【问题标题】:delayed_job restart would restart all processes correctly?delay_job restart 会正确重启所有进程吗?
【发布时间】:2016-05-23 11:57:17
【问题描述】:

所以,当我开始 DJ 时,我会这样做:

RAILS_ENV=production ./script/delayed_job --pool=user,op,fb:2 --pool=mail,intercom,low,default:2 start

我的问题是:当我重新启动它时,我需要指定相同的参数吗?也就是说,下面的命令就够了吗?

RAILS_ENV=production ./script/delayed_job restart

还是我停止它,然后再次发出启动命令?

【问题讨论】:

    标签: ruby-on-rails-3.2 delayed-job


    【解决方案1】:

    我自己来回答,是的。 DJ 将在自己的位置正确地重新启动当前进程。

    2016-05-31T06:25:59+0000: [Worker(delayed_job host:*** pid:699)] Exiting...
    2016-05-31T06:26:03+0000: [Worker(delayed_job host:*** pid:709)] Exiting...
    2016-05-31T06:26:05+0000: [Worker(delayed_job host:*** pid:716)] Exiting...
    2016-05-31T06:26:10+0000: [Worker(delayed_job host:*** pid:723)] Exiting...
    2016-05-31T06:26:16+0000: [Worker(delayed_job host:*** pid:29890)] Starting job worker
    2016-05-31T06:26:16+0000: [Worker(delayed_job host:*** pid:29897)] Starting job worker
    2016-05-31T06:26:16+0000: [Worker(delayed_job host:*** pid:29915)] Starting job worker
    2016-05-31T06:26:16+0000: [Worker(delayed_job host:*** pid:29907)] Starting job worker
    

    类似的东西。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2021-12-18
      • 2018-02-20
      • 2014-04-28
      • 1970-01-01
      • 1970-01-01
      • 2010-12-31
      相关资源
      最近更新 更多